The Advantages Of A Burr Grinder Over A Blade Grinder

If you make a comparison between burr grinders and blade grinders, you will find your answer on your own. The main disadvantage of a blade grinder is, it can’t grind the beans evenly.

If you look at your ground coffee after using a blade grinder, you will see coarser and finer beans in the same batch. How does that affect your coffee? If you’ve got a hundred different particle sizes out of one batch, every size is going to extract the coffee differently. So the taste will be all over the place. 

Moreover, it raises the temperature while grinding. Eventually, the beans are burnt. But the burr grinder can grind the beans evenly. Also, it will not raise the temperature while grinding.
